Pantoprazole is a proton pump inhibitor drug. That is it is medicine or drug that inhibits specifically and dose proportionally the gastricH+, K+ ATPase enzyme which is responsible for acid secretion in the parietal cells of the stomach. The drug acts by blocking the production of acid by the stomach.

Iupac Name of Pantoprazole

5-(difluoromethoxy)- 2-[(3,4-dimethoxypyridin-2-yl) methylsulfinyl]- 3H-benzoimidazole

Dosage of Pantoprazole Tablets

> One tablet per day, either during or before breakfast.
Duodenal ulcer: 1 tablet for 2 weeks
Gastric ulcer: 1 tablet for 4 weeks
Gastro-oesophageal reflux: 1 tablet for 4 weeks

Contra- Indications: Hypersensitivity to any of the constituents

Use of Pantoprazole

The Pantoprazole medicine is used for short-term treatment gastric ulcer. It treats the erosion and ulceration of the esophagus produced by gastroesophageal reflux disease. The treatment takes 2 months time initially. If the problem continues, another 8 week course of treatment is given to the patient. The same medicine can be used as a maintenance therapy for long term use after initial response is attained.

Side Effects of Pantoprazole

> The drug has certain side effects, that can affect individuals in different ways. The following are some of the side effects, that are often associated with the drug:
  • Headache
  • Diarrhoea
  • Dizziness
  • Pruritis
